Smoked Duck Leg Pizza

Cut off all meat from the duck leg(s), and reserve. On the stove top immerse the bones in some hearty red wine with tomato sauce, chopped garlic clove, reduce to a spreadable consistency. Let cool. Top the pizza dough with the sauce, mushrooms, the wilder the better, duck meat and olives. Bake on a pizza stone a highest oven setting. Enjoy with a bottle of a good red wine. Bravo.

(The smoked duck leg was found at a local Asian market, so this is a superb example of East meets west.)
